The Jungle, Calais, France. Friday January 15th 2016. New government built container accommodation for 1000 refugees. Each heated container houses up to 15 refugees. To get a bed, refugees sign up. Entrance and exit is by hand scanning. Around 6000 men, women and children live at the camp which is slowly being cleared.
